Transaction 068fa8162341980534a4664e79167e8d62f35c6f75752620e3e33ce4c7cd073b
1 Input
1 Output
-
068fa8162341980534a4664e79167e8d62f35c6f75752620e3e33ce4c7cd073b:0
- value
- 33822865
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2562ba95a7c0832983e930a2fafa4e67776fb18
- address
- bc1quftzh2260syr9xp7jv9zltayuemhd7ccck7su0